Who is at risk for sudden cardiac arrest?

0

SCA is difficult to predict and most victims have no prior symptoms. Anyone who has suffered SCA, a heart attack, or knows they have an arrhythmia may be at greater risk for this malady. While the average age of sudden cardiac arrest victims is around 65, sudden cardiac arrest can strike anyone, anywhere, and at anytime.
